Kenneth Largess

Deputy General Counsel And Chief Compliance Officer at Abrams Capital

Kenneth Largess has extensive legal and compliance experience, serving as Deputy General Counsel and Chief Compliance Officer at Abrams Capital since August 2010. Prior to this role, Kenneth held the position of Executive Director at Morgan Stanley from September 2006 to August 2010. Kenneth began their career at Bingham McCutchen LLP, where Kenneth worked as an Associate from December 2004 to August 2006. Kenneth is a graduate of Boston College Law School.

Abrams Capital

Abrams Capital is a Boston-based investment firm founded in 1999 by David Abrams. The firm’s investment strategy is opportunistic and follows a fundamental, value-oriented approach. Investments generally are made with a long-term time horizon and are typically unlevered and long-biased. Abrams Capital and its affiliates have invested across a wide spectrum of asset types, investment strategies, market sectors, market cycles and industries. This spectrum includes, but is not limited to, domestic and foreign equity and debt securities, distressed securities, and private and/or illiquid investments.
